Rev. Jen Nagel's Extraordinary Ordination - 01-18-2008
After years of serving as a Pastoral Minister in Minneapolis’s Salem English Lutheran Church, Jen Nagel was “extraordinarily ordained” by Extraordinary Lutheran Ministries, a nonprofit organization dedicated to credentialing openly LGBT people for ministry.
Presbyterian Church Votes ‘Yes’ to Lesbian Clergy - 01-17-2008
Despite heavy opposition and two previous denials, the San Francisco Presbytery voted 167-151 to pass Lisa Larges, an open lesbian, on toward ordination.
